Outline of Final Research Achievements

The purpose of this project was to develop the analytical method for multi-component identification of molecules based on surface-enhanced Raman spectroscopy using a gold nanoparticle dimer with single molecule sensitivity. Due to the Raman enhancing hotspot with 1 nm nanogap in the single dimer, for the first time, the single oligomer detection and analysis was demonstrated. The dimer identified the several bases and backbone components of the single DNA oligomer. The dynamics of the single oligomer could be analyzed. The oligomer was trapped and stayed at the nanogap hotspot, and fluctuated with rotation.
